Stuffed Crust Pepperoni Pizza is a popular variation of the classic pizza, featuring a crust edge filled with melted cheese (often mozzarella) and topped with tomato sauce, cheese, and slices of pepperoni. It originated in the United States, notably popularized by major pizza chains in the 1990s as an indulgent twist on traditional pizza.

🍽️ Nutrition at a glance

This dish is typically high in carbohydrates from the crust, fat from the cheese and pepperoni, and provides a moderate amount of protein. A single slice (about 1/8 of a 14-inch pizza) can contain around 300-400 calories, with key nutrients including calcium from the cheese and iron from the enriched flour.

💡 What's interesting

Culturally, the stuffed crust pizza represents a creative marketing innovation in the fast-food industry, designed to enhance the eating experience by turning the often-discarded crust edge into a flavorful highlight. Nutritionally, the added cheese in the crust significantly increases the calorie and fat content compared to standard pizza, making it a more energy-dense option.
